The Office on Trafficking in Persons (OTIP) is interested in procuring navigator support and graduated services for survivors of trafficking who have completed their enrollment period in an OTIP grant program providing comprehensive case management services. The vendor will assist program participants nationwide to reach economic mobility goals through connections to safe housing, education, financial services, legal aid, and employment opportunities. (b) Purpose: As part of its market research, OTIP is issuing this RFI to determine: (i) the most suitable approach to develop a Statement of Work and procure services for the aforementioned requirement; (ii) if there are an adequate number of qualified interested GSA Schedule contractors capable of providing support as further described in the attached Statement of Need (Attachment A); (iii) whether the requirement is suitable for a small business set-aside; and (iv) responses from industry to further develop the requirement.
